Hello Everyone,

As many of you know our family welcomed beautiful twins 11 days ago named Alycen (born at 2.1 lbs) and Spence (born at 1.7 lbs), although wonderful news, they were born premature. Due to medical complications the doctors decided that the best hope for them was to bring the children into the world at 26 weeks pre-term (3 months early). Obviously with being born this early they have struggled and fought to stay with us, but every day is a challenge. Spence is beginning to be stabilize and continues to strengthen everyday but will remain in the NICU until December.

Alycen has not been as fortunate, she struggles with reoccurring holes developing in both of her lungs and struggles to breathe. The doctors have now moved her to a larger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U) at another hospital to perform a procedure to re-locate a chest tube in hopes of improving her condition. She has also suffered some brain hemorrhaging that caused swelling and the doctors are trying their best to monitor it closely as well. Many days and hours have been touch and go as Aly fights so hard to cling to life and heal. She has had a harder time in the short two weeks of her life than many people ever have in a lifetime. Her heart stopped beating a few nights ago and had to be resuscitated. God performed a miracle and brought her sweet heart back to life.

The byproduct of this change in care has caused the twins to now be separated across the city at different NICU hospitals. The unimaginable struggle for Alycen and the distance between both babies is also causing stress on Spence as well. He is often fussy and needs extra love & care.
